Osmar N. Silva has authored 65 papers that have received a total of 1.8k indexed citations.
This includes 38 papers in Molecular Biology, 31 papers in Microbiology and 13 papers in Immunology. The topics of these papers are Antimicrobial Peptides and Activities (31 papers), Biochemical and Structural Characterization (19 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(8 papers). Osmar N. Silva is often cited by papers focused on Antimicrobial Peptides and Activities (31 papers), Biochemical and Structural Characterization (19 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(8 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Brazil, United States and India. Osmar N. Silva's co-authors include Octávio Luiz Franco, William F. Porto, Ludovico Migliolo, Isabel C. M. Fensterseifer and Simoni Campos Dias and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and PLoS ONE.
